I'm putting down a transfer I'm printing out there, Axel. It's a "negative", a clear Lugganath symbol outlined in black. The clear will show the orange through it, and I'll just paint up to the black outline. That way, I don't have to print out orange and worry about color matching it and putting it over black paint (transfers are never fully opaque).

I'm calling the Scorpions done, painting-wise. I hit them with one more highlight on each color and finished up the other two tanks this past week. If I have time this weekend I hope to hit them with a glosscote so I can put the transfers on, and then dullcote them and put the tufts on the bases.
